Step-by-Step: How to Find the Divisors of 12750

An efficient way to find divisors uses the complementary pair trick: check each integer i from 1 to √12750 ≈ 112.92. If i divides 12750, then both i and 12750/i are divisors.

  1. 1 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 1 = 12750) → pair (1, 12750)
  2. 2 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 2 = 6375) → pair (2, 6375)
  3. 3 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 3 = 4250) → pair (3, 4250)
  4. 5 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 5 = 2550) → pair (5, 2550)
  5. 6 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 6 = 2125) → pair (6, 2125)
  6. 10 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 10 = 1275) → pair (10, 1275)
  7. 15 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 15 = 850) → pair (15, 850)
  8. 17 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 17 = 750) → pair (17, 750)
  9. 25 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 25 = 510) → pair (25, 510)
  10. 30 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 30 = 425) → pair (30, 425)
  11. 34 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 34 = 375) → pair (34, 375)
  12. 50 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 50 = 255) → pair (50, 255)
  13. 51 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 51 = 250) → pair (51, 250)
  14. 75 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 75 = 170) → pair (75, 170)
  15. 85 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 85 = 150) → pair (85, 150)
  16. 102 divides 12750 (12750 ÷ 102 = 125) → pair (102, 125)
  17. Collect all unique values: {1, 2, 3, 5, 6, 10, 15, 17, 25, 30, 34, 50, 51, 75, 85, 102, 125, 150, 170, 250, 255, 375, 425, 510, 750, 850, 1275, 2125, 2550, 4250, 6375, 12750} — total 32 divisors.
  18. Sum: 1 + 2 + 3 + 5 + 6 + 10 + 15 + 17 + 25 + 30 + 34 + 50 + 51 + 75 + 85 + 102 + 125 + 150 + 170 + 250 + 255 + 375 + 425 + 510 + 750 + 850 + 1275 + 2125 + 2550 + 4250 + 6375 + 12750 = 33696.

What Is a Divisor?

A divisor (also called a factor) of a positive integer n is any positive integer d such that n ÷ d has no remainder. In other words, d divides n evenly.

Every positive integer n has at least two divisors: 1 and n itself (with 1 being the trivial case of having only itself). Numbers with exactly 2 divisors are prime; numbers with 3 or more divisors are composite.
